## Changelog — PagerMuffle v3.2

Heads up: we changed the default dedup window from 5 to 15 minutes. Too many folks were getting triple-paged for the same flapping check, and the old default was chosen back when Driftbay ran one cluster. Suppression now keys on alert fingerprint plus service tag instead of hostname, so host churn won't punch through the window. Nothing touches auth paths, but please eyeball the suppression rules anyway. Current defaults as shipped are listed below.

deployment values, yadup-kadug:
[sorys]
port = 5672
team = noveth
host = sorys.orvexcorp.example
region = south-4
access_code = ac_deddc1
timeout_ms = 1500

- [ ] **Step 7: Breaker override escrow.** After sealing the signing keys for the Tallgrove upstream API circuit breaker, confirm the support team can force the breaker open during a full outage. The override bundle lives in the sealed escrow drawer and is useless without its unlock phrase. Two ceremony witnesses must initial this step before proceeding. The escrow bundle is decrypted with the recovery passphrase that follows.

vault phrase of kahip-kahop = holath-quenmir

## Onboarding: Autocomplete Index

Welcome to the Plumeline search team. The typeahead on the merchant portal is slow because the autocomplete index on `product_names` is a plain btree over a lowercased expression; it can't serve infix matches, so those queries fall back to sequential scans. Your first task is evaluating a trigram index on the staging copy. Connect to that staging database with the string below.

primary connection of yagep-kahip = redis://giliel_svc:zYiKsLL2PLpfPL@db-348f.xolmarsys.corp:5432/fenwyn